Некоторые преимущества использования SSE (Server-Sent Events) перед WebSockets в корпоративных системах:
- Меньшая нагрузка на процессор и память. tproger.ru SSE поддерживает только однонаправленное соединение, что снижает нагрузку на процессор и память по сравнению с WebSockets. tproger.ru
- Оптимизированная работа в сетях. tproger.ru SSE использует HTTP и работает на стандартных портах, что облегчает работу через прокси и балансировщики нагрузки и позволяет эффективнее использовать сетевые ресурсы. tproger.ru
- Энергосбережение на мобильных устройствах. tproger.ru SSE менее требователен к энергии на мобильных устройствах, чем WebSockets, так как не требует постоянного пинга для поддержания соединения. tproger.ru
- Поддержка стандартных сетей и кэширования. tproger.ru SSE работает поверх HTTP и использует текстовые данные, что упрощает поддержку в корпоративных сетях и через прокси-серверы. tproger.ru
- Простота внедрения. dzen.ru SSE намного легче интегрировать и использовать, чем WebSockets, особенно для задач, где требуется только передача данных сервером. dzen.ru
Выбор между SSE и WebSockets зависит от требований конкретного приложения и от того, как данные должны передаваться между клиентом и сервером. tproger.ru